However, it may not be easy to get to your television for every preseason game, and a lot of fans have turned to streaming for their content to avoid having to pay for cable and to watch on the go. If you’re looking to watch preseason games online, you’re in luck.

ESPN and their WatchESPN live stream service will provide some games online, but the best way to get in on all of the action is to check out NFL Game Pass.

Fans can buy NFL Game Pass to check out the entire NFL preseason, and the service will carry over to give you on demand replays of regular season games for $99 total. You’ll be able to stream games on phones, tablets, computers, and gaming consoles like the Xbox One and Playstation 4. To add on, you can stream it on Apple TV, Google Chromecast and Roku for even more options.
